summaryrefslogtreecommitdiffstats
path: root/auth/auth-cass/docker/drun.sh
diff options
context:
space:
mode:
authorInstrumental <jonathan.gathman@att.com>2018-11-02 16:08:34 -0500
committerInstrumental <jonathan.gathman@att.com>2018-11-02 16:18:43 -0500
commit014494d662fee62eb0911b693aa6baf0ba54e26f (patch)
tree6f4cbf62574ef7117d0320c6a8698a3fe5298dd1 /auth/auth-cass/docker/drun.sh
parent5ccce038286f0629be14fc7530d7bcd218d00616 (diff)
DB Recover
Single DB stoppages not recovering Issue-ID: AAF-605 Change-Id: Ic79c2f71d5142009e7b02896e954980117037e06 Signed-off-by: Instrumental <jonathan.gathman@att.com>
Diffstat (limited to 'auth/auth-cass/docker/drun.sh')
-rw-r--r--auth/auth-cass/docker/drun.sh5
1 files changed, 5 insertions, 0 deletions
diff --git a/auth/auth-cass/docker/drun.sh b/auth/auth-cass/docker/drun.sh
index 21de1ac4..1bcff83c 100644
--- a/auth/auth-cass/docker/drun.sh
+++ b/auth/auth-cass/docker/drun.sh
@@ -6,6 +6,10 @@ if [ -e ../../docker/d.props ]; then
fi
DOCKER=${DOCKER:-docker}
+if [ "$1" = "publish" ]; then
+ PUBLISH='--publish 9042:9042 '
+fi
+
if [ "$($DOCKER volume ls | grep aaf_cass_data)" = "" ]; then
$DOCKER volume create aaf_cass_data
echo "Created Cassandra Volume aaf_cass_data"
@@ -23,6 +27,7 @@ if [ "`$DOCKER ps -a | grep aaf_cass`" == "" ]; then
-e CASSANDRA_DC=dc1 \
-e CASSANDRA_CLUSTER_NAME=osaaf \
-v "aaf_cass_data:/var/lib/cassandra" \
+ $PUBLISH \
-d ${PREFIX}${ORG}/${PROJECT}/aaf_cass:${VERSION} "onap"
else
$DOCKER start aaf_cass